Terex Globals Boost to Suicide Prevention Services
Local business gives big boost to suicide prevention services.
A Craigavon business’ push to generate funds for suicide prevention and awareness pays off after their year-long charity endeavour comes to an end.
Employees from Terex Global Business Services in Silverwood Business Park have spent the last year focusing on raising as much as possible for PIPS Hope and Support, a charity that provides vital mental health services to residents across the wider community.
On Monday 24th February, representatives from Terex GBS Fundraising Committee presented a cheque to the charity for £8,490.00 - a culmination of their 2019 year-long fundraising drive.
PIPS Hope and Support thank the staff who were completely committed and consistent in delivering charity focused events throughout the year with the aim to achieve as much money as possible for our services. We wish to take this opportunity to truly thank them not only for this huge donation, but also for the huge awareness they have created for our charity.
Terex team members participated in the Newry 10k sponsored run and organised a number of fundraising events including a quiz, a golf sweepstake, odd socks day, and various cake sales throughout the year.
Cheryl Magookin, GBS UK Finance Director said: “At Terex we operate through our six company values, one of which is Citizenship; and encourage Team Members to give back to their local community. We were delighted to present PIPS Charity with a cheque for over £8,000 that will go towards supporting its work in suicide prevention and bereavement support, right across Northern Ireland. It is the culmination of hard work, dedication and generosity by the entire GBS UK team and their families and I’d like to thank them all for getting involved in the wide range of fundraising and volunteering activities throughout the year.”
